How to select Science research topics

Although many students consider the writing phase as the tedious part of writing, coming up with a topic might be the most challenging part. When considering a topic for your essay:

  1. Check the existing research in your field

Existing dissertation and publications are a great start for your science research topics research. After receiving your research paper topic, run the keyword through various platforms to check for ideas that have not been exhausted.

You may opt to start off with a Wikipedia search to pinpoint the resources that are relevant to your research question. Next, gauge how often an idea has been studied and refrain from the topics that have been subject to multiple studies.

Settling for an exhausted topic limits your ideas, causing a high likelihood of plagiarism. 

  1. Consider your interests

Settling for science topics for middle school that does not pique your interest is a surefire way toward failure. An interesting topic pushes you to do more research, making the writing process more bearable. 

Also, consider checking the emerging issues in your field to determine the original ideas you can write about. Avoid going for a complex topic in a bid to ‘intimidate’ your tutor as this may cause you to get stuck or cause you to surpass your prescribed word count. 

  1. Consult your peers

Brainstorming for high school science research paper topics with friends is better than a solo approach. When discussing ideas with your friends you can get new perspectives on the topic, thus finding an A-level research paper topic.

This contribution of ideas helps you overcome personal biases, and objectively consider the relevance of a research idea. 

  1. Put the word count in mind

Often, in a bid to surprise your tutor, students take on complex earth science topics that cannot be managed in the prescribed word count. For this, you can outline your points after research, gauging the extent of your topic.

What is a term paper?

A term paper is an analytical report, usually submitted at the end of a semester, entailing the investigation of various ideas you’ve encountered over the term. This paper, therefore, allows a tutor to gauge the progress of a learner and their capacity to apply the studied concepts in solving various problems.

How to write a term paper

Like all academic papers, quality research and planning are essential for an outstanding term paper. We recommend the following steps when approaching your term paper. 

  1. Choose a topic

Topic selection is the most crucial step in writing a term paper. After receiving the research question from your tutor, brainstorm various topics that pique your interest within the broad term paper question. 

You may also consult the current issues in the topic to determine an interesting topic to write on. Ideally, go for a topic that interests you as this provides the needed motivation to exhaust arguments in a paper.

  1. Research the topic

After selecting various topics, conduct thorough research to gauge the availability of sources to support your claims. Be keen to drop arguments that have been tackled by previous researchers as this may limit your arguments, or lead to plagiarism.

When researching the topic, jot down the key research questions and record ideas that support your argument. We recommend that you keep a meticulous record of references to reduce the hassle of retrieving them upon completion of your paper.

  1. Outline your topic

Coalesce the ideas you found out during the research and organize them into paragraphs to make a quality argument. Outlining your topic helps organize your ideas to achieve flow and also to gauge the sections that require further investigation.

  1. Draft your paper

With your outline in hand, expand on various ideas to achieve a flow of arguments and engage your readers. Be keen not to investigate ideas that are not indicated in your outline as this could open loopholes for criticism. 

  1. Revise your draft

After writing your draft, analyze your paper to determine the completeness of arguments and check for various errors in grammar, structure, and referencing. Term paper outline

Like most papers, a term paper comprises an introduction, a literature review, a body, and a conclusion. 

  1. Introduction

The introduction of the term paper comprises the background of the topic as it is vital to justify your research. Your introduction should also offer a summary of your key arguments and introduce your thesis statement.

  1. Literature review

The literature review is an overview of how your idea has been tackled in existing work. This section should acknowledge milestone publications in your field and highlight weaknesses in various works. 

  1. Body

The body of your paper outlines your claims and supports your arguments in a couple of paragraphs. Each paragraph carries a unique idea and builds on the previous claim, leading to your standpoint.

  1. Conclusion

The conclusion should summarize your findings according to the term paper objectives. Was your thesis true? If it was, show how the research has debunked common counterarguments. You may also prescribe future studies that can be conducted to further investigate the idea.  

APA term paper format

The APA format is commonly prescribed for term papers. Some of the rules for writing a term paper in APA include:

  • A times new roman size 12 font
  • Double line spacing 
  • Leave a 1-inch margin on every side of a page
  • Indent every first sentence in your paragraphs
